Default Need experience - swapping speakers but keeping stock Bose

Can't redo the whole system. Is it worth upgrading speakers while keeping stock head unit on a 2001 C5 Vert? I get conflicting advice from car stereo shops. Please reply with brand and model numbers whereby sound improved.

I wouldn't...

I guess the question that begs to be asked... why can't you redo the entire system?

If it's money - wait until you can afford to do it right.

If it's a lease car - don't do it at all.

If your worried the warrantee will be voided, don't. SEMA has fought in court to protect an owners right to install aftermarket components.

I agree with Bogus. Save your money, the stereo is as only good as the weakest link. In your case that would be Bose HU and the interface wiring harness.
